:以太坊钱包智能合约的真假辨别指南
引言
以太坊是一个去中心化的平台,支持智能合约的创建和运行。在以太坊网络上,用户可以创建、管理钱包以及通过这些钱包与智能合约互动。然而,随着越来越多的使用案例出现,关于以太坊钱包和智能合约的安全性和真实性的问题也逐渐被放大。本文旨在解析如何辨别以太坊钱包和智能合约的真假,帮助用户保护自己的数字资产。
以太坊钱包的基本概念
以太坊钱包是一种数字化工具,允许用户存储以太坊(ETH)和其他基于以太坊的代币。钱包的功能包括发送、接收和管理不同的代币,同时它也可以与智能合约进行交互。以太坊钱包主要分为热钱包和冷钱包两种类型:
- 热钱包:这类钱包通常在线使用,如网上钱包和移动应用,便于随时访问和交易。
- 冷钱包:这指的是离线存储的方式,如硬件钱包和纸钱包,安全性较高。
了解这些基本概念后,用户能够更好地选择适合自己的钱包。然而,选择钱包时,真实性是首要考虑的因素。
智能合约简介
智能合约是一种自动执行合约条款的程序,它们在以太坊区块链上运行。用户通过智能合约可以完成各种交易和互动,如发行代币、去中心化交易所等。智能合约的主要优势在于去中心化、透明性和不可篡改性,但这也不乏风险,用户需要对其真实性进行仔细核验。
辨别以太坊钱包和智能合约真假方法
下面列出了一些辨别以太坊钱包和智能合约真假的有效方法和技巧:
1. 检查官网和开发者信息
首先,确保你要使用的钱包或智能合约源于官方渠道。查看官方网站,确认其开发团队的背景、社交媒体账号,以及社区支持。一个可靠的项目一般会有一定的用户基础和频繁的开发更新。特别小心那些缺乏透明度或匿名开发者的项目。
2. 社区评价
以太坊有一个活跃的社区,用户可以在不同的平台上找到对特定钱包或智能合约的评价。例如,Reddit、Twitter、Telegram等,看看用户的反馈和评论。如果存在大量负面反馈,或者警告信息,建议谨慎使用。
3. 智能合约代码审核
如果你熟悉编程,可以对智能合约的源代码进行审核。以太坊上的智能合约是公开的,任何人都可以查看其代码。审计公司如Quantstamp和OpenZeppelin等,也可以为热门的或复杂的智能合约提供审核服务。如果一个智能合约未经过第三方审计,或者代码难以理解,使用的风险会大大增加。
4. 测试交易
在使用新的钱包或智能合约进行大额交易之前,可以先进行少量测试交易。这种方式可以帮助你确认交易的真实性和安全性。如果测试交易能够顺利完成,可以考虑再进行大额交易。当心确认交易信息,比如地址和金额。
5. 使用推荐的工具
有许多工具和网站可以帮助你验证以太坊钱包和智能合约的真实性。例如,通过Etherscan查看合约的交易历史和持有人数,也可以确认该合约的来源及其是否已经被广泛使用。
常见问题
1. 如何保护我的以太坊钱包不被盗取?
保护以太坊钱包不被盗取是每个用户的首要任务。首先,强烈建议使用冷钱包进行大额资金的储存和管理。冷钱包无连接互联网,在黑客攻击的可能性上大大降低。其次,定期更新密码和做双重身份验证。此外,用户也应对其私钥做好保管,不随便外泄,绝对不要在不明网站输入私钥信息。使用强大、复杂的密码,并避免重复使用相同的密码在不同的平台上。
2. 如何判断某个智能合约是否安全?
判断智能合约是否安全的关键在于审计和透明性。选择经过知名审计机构审计过的合约,这将大大降低风险。同时检查合约的开源代码,也可以认识其逻辑是否合理。可使用专业工具进行漏洞扫描。最后,区块链上的交易记录透明,可以通过市场的反馈和表现来间接判断合约的安全性。
3. 为什么许多以太坊钱包会出现钓鱼网站?
钓鱼攻击在加密货币领域相当普遍。由于加密货币缺乏监管,许多新的项目也难以验证其真实性,使得黑客有机可趁。钓鱼攻击通常通过伪造网站,诱导用户输入私钥或助记词。一些攻击者专门创建与知名钱包非常相似的网站,因此用户在输入敏感信息前,一定要仔细检查网站的URL,确保是官方渠道。
4. 如何进行智能合约的实际测试?
进行智能合约的实际测试可以通过以下步骤:首先准备一个测试网络(如Ropsten、Rinkeby),这些都是真实的以太坊环境,但使用的是测试币。在测试环境中,对需要测试的智能合约进行实际的交易,将能够观察到合约行为。此外,可以通过编写不同类型的交互脚本,以模拟用户操作,检验合约的执行逻辑和稳定性。对于较为复杂的合约,建议在测试完成后进行压力测试,以确保合约能够在高负荷下依然保持活跃状态。
5. 如何选择可靠的以太坊钱包和智能合约?
选择可靠的以太坊钱包和智能合约,可以遵循以下几点:首先,了解钱包和合约的开发背景与团队实力。其次,关注其市场表现,用户反馈及讨论。可以查阅业界有关的新闻和报告,了解其在安全性、用户体验等方面的评价。最后,审计记录和开源代码也是不可忽视的因素,选择那些经过广泛审计且开源的合约与钱包。
总结
以太坊钱包和智能合约的真实与否直接关系到用户的数字资产安全。通过本指南,用户可以更好地理解如何辨别钱包和智能合约的真假,从而保护自己的资金不受损失。在数字资产的世界中,保持警惕并做好充分的研究始终是避免风险的最好方式。